I was wondering if there is a  paint code for the  aluminum color on the rear rims for the wd45's.  I prefer PPG paint and want the correct tint.  I've seen some real bright tinted rims that don't look right.  The tractor is painted the correct orange and I want the rims to look like they came originally from the factory.  Thanks you.

From the Factor they were Galvanized not painted so Any color that looks galvanized to you is good. Glavanized metal starts out bright and darkens every year, so the color will change.

If they have never been painted, look into getting them regalvanized.  At one time there was a place in Rockford, IL that would do the first 600# for $150, and the price went down from there.  That's probably 8-10 rims.  Almost cheaper than painting them.
